Community

Art thrives where community thrives.


Hamilton Studio School supports art initiatives in the community by partnering with groups and organizations, helping them to execute projects and express a collective vision in a range of art forms.

Cootes Paradise Elementary School Mural

  

Hamilton Studio School collaborated with Cootes Paradise Elementary School to create a playground mural on the outdoor shed.


Each week for three months we met with our team of 16 mural club students (grades 3-5) to develop the conceptual framework, build the composition, enhance the work with details, select a colour palette and paint the final work on site.  The children brought creative focus and energy to every stage of the project, as did the amazing teaching personnel and Home and School Association volunteers who worked with us.


The children created a community artwork that portrays play, friendship, diversity, belonging and joy in the natural world.
